In the fall of 2017, I watched 19,000 fans bow down to Zac Brown Band during a 25-song marathon set at MidFlorida Credit Union Amphitheatre.
“There are about a dozen times during a Zac Brown show when it feels like another 1 a.m. at another local beach bar,” I wrote. “It’s the smell of saltwater and sweat, the hot aroma of alcohol breath, and it’s the sound of a cover band playing ‘It’s A Great Day To Be Alive’ while the leatheriest old-timers this side of Spring Break sing along without a care.”
And that’s why I’m not surprised to find a Zac Brown tribute act playing this Treasure Island beach bar on Friday. The Foundation gets pretty close most of the time, including when it takes on Brown’s medley of “Free” and Van Morrison’s “Into The Mystic,” so go ahead and give yourself permission to stick your toes in the sand for this one.
